Ingredients
For the Cake
- 1 cup sifted all-purpose flour
- ½ cup sugar
- ¾ tablespoon baking powder (make sure it’s not expired)
- 3 large eggs (at room temperature)
- ½ cup avocado oil (any neutral cooking oil)
- 3 medium apples (peeled and diced small) (I used honey crisp (2 to 2 1/2 cups of diced apple total))
- ½ cup milk
- 2 tablespoons butter
- 2 tablespoons sugar
For Garnish
- Powdered sugar (for dusting)

How to Make Easy Apple Cake
Step 1: Preheat the Oven
Preheat your oven to 375°F. Spray a 7-inch springform pan with baking spray and line it with parchment paper. If you opt for a larger pan, keep an eye on the baking time since it may vary due to the thinner cake.
Step 2: Mix Dry Ingredients
In a mixing bowl, add the flour, sugar, and baking powder. Stir these dry ingredients together until well combined.
Step 3: Combine Wet Ingredients
Add the eggs and avocado oil into the dry mixture. Stir until everything is fully combined; aim for a thick but smooth batter.
Step 4: Fold in Apples
Gently fold in the diced apples until they are completely coated with the batter.
Step 5: Bake
Pour the batter into your prepared springform pan. Bake for 35 to 40 minutes or until a toothpick inserted comes out clean.
Step 6: Prepare Milk Mixture
About five minutes before your cake is done, warm the milk, butter, and sugar in a small pot over medium heat. Whisk until everything has dissolved completely.
Step 7: Poke Holes in Cake
Once baked, remove the cake from the oven. Using a skewer or chopstick, poke about 25 to 30 holes evenly across the top of the cake.
Step 8: Pour Milk Mixture Over Cake
Gently pour the warm milk mixture over the top of your cake. It will absorb this delightful liquid as it cools.
Step 9: Cool and Serve
After allowing it to absorb completely, take off the springform and parchment paper. Let cool on a plate for about 10 to 15 minutes before enjoying! Optionally dust with powdered sugar before serving for added sweetness.

Common Mistakes to Avoid
Baking an Easy Apple Cake can be simple, but there are a few common mistakes that can affect your result. Here are some tips to ensure your cake turns out perfectly every time.
-
Using expired baking powder: Always check the expiration date of your baking powder. If it’s expired, the cake may not rise properly, leading to a dense texture.
-
Overmixing the batter: Mixing the batter too much can lead to a tough cake. Stir until just combined, and don’t worry if the mixture is slightly lumpy.
-
Not measuring apples properly: Using too many or too few apples can change the cake’s texture. Aim for about 2 to 2 1/2 cups of diced apples for the best flavor and moisture.
-
Skipping the milk mixture step: Pouring warm milk over the cake adds moisture and flavor. Skipping this step might result in a drier cake.
-
Not letting it cool properly: Allowing the cake to cool for 10-15 minutes helps set its texture. Cutting it too soon can make it fall apart.
Refrigerator Storage
- Easy Apple Cake can be stored in the refrigerator for up to 4 days.
- Use an airtight container or cover it tightly with plastic wrap to keep it fresh.
Freezing Easy Apple Cake
- You can freeze slices of Easy Apple Cake for up to 3 months.
- Wrap each slice in plastic wrap and then place them in a freezer-safe bag or container.
Reheating Easy Apple Cake
- Oven: Preheat to 350°F (175°C). Place slices on a baking sheet and heat for about 10-15 minutes until warmed through.
- Microwave: Heat individual slices on medium power for about 30-45 seconds or until warm.
- Stovetop: Place slices in a skillet over low heat, cover, and warm for about 5 minutes, flipping halfway through.

Frequently Asked Questions
Can I use other fruits in my Easy Apple Cake?
Yes! You can substitute apples with other fruits like pears or peaches. Just make sure they are diced small enough for even cooking.
How do I know when my Easy Apple Cake is done?
The cake is done when a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ean. Baking time may vary based on your oven and pan size.
What makes this Easy Apple Cake so moist?
The combination of diced apples and the warm milk mixture ensures that your cake remains moist and flavorful throughout.
Can I make this recipe gluten-free?
Absolutely! Substitute all-purpose flour with a gluten-free flour blend designed for baking, making sure it has xanthan gum for structure.
